Output 64bc08fb23b40a6ce9d8a8c43e2e46e128219156ab2df2ecd4defe86f88e2e02:1

value
117959
script pubkey
OP_0 OP_PUSHBYTES_20 c2001d163e01964f18fdcc424628988155d4cf32
address
bc1qcgqp6937qxty7x8ae3pyv2ycs92afnejktqqgz
transaction
64bc08fb23b40a6ce9d8a8c43e2e46e128219156ab2df2ecd4defe86f88e2e02
confirmations
97424
spent
true